Public consultation on opportunities offered by digital technologies for the culture heritage sector

The European Commission launched a public consultation in view of the evaluation and possible revision of its main policy instrument to support the digital transformation of the cultural heritage sector. Digitization of cultural heritage, especially in high quality and with advanced technologies, can provide significant support to conservation, renovation, study and promotion of European cultural assets. In an age of accelerated global digital transformation, digitized cultural heritage items made available online are valuable resources for education, entertainment or further re-use. They also give a lot of visibility to Europe’s cultural diversity and can inspire a sense of belonging and shared European values….

Edinburgh Congress 2020 – Current Practices & Challenges in Built Heritage Conservation

The International Institute of Conservation’s (IIC) Edinburgh Congress “Practices and Challenges in Built Heritage Conservation” will take place online from 2 – 6 November 2020 – with opportunities for real world meet ups and livestreamed tours of remarkable built heritage across Edinburgh’s UNESCO World Heritage site and surrounding areas. The program bridges the divide between built heritage and conservation around the world – with international sessions on the Mackintosh Building and Burrell Collection as well as examples of wall paintings at the Fengguo Temple in Yixian, China, to preservation strategies for painted tombs at El-Kurru, Sudan. Recruiting 15 international PhD students in Marie Curie ITN SUBLime

Docomomo International informs that the SUBLime network is currently looking for dedicated and highly motivated Early Stage Researchers (ESR), who will join our team to craft the future of lime mortars/plasters in new construction and conservation of the built heritage. They are recruiting 15 international PhD students to be trained as European experts in Sustainable Building Lime applications via Circular Economy and Biomimetic Approaches (SUBLime). SUBLime is an European Training Network (ETN) program that will start in February 2021, as a Marie-Sklodowska-Curie action (Innovative Training Network – ITN) involving 9 countries in Europe. Demolition of the MLC Building. Sign the petition!

Docomomo International became aware by Docomomo Australia about the worrying situation of the current heritage-listed MLC Building. The MLC Building is set to be demolished under a development application for a new commercial office building submitted to North Sydney Council. The MLC Building has been an important part of the history and streetscape of North Sydney for over 60 years and remains one of the few buildings in the North Sydney CBD possessing any good civic or aesthetic qualities. “Keeping It Modern” Getty Foundation distinguishes FAUP project for Álvaro Siza’s Swimming Pools

Docomomo International is glad to inform that the project by the Faculty of Architecture of the University of Porto (FAUP), which counted with the participation of Professor Ana Tostões, Chair of Docomomo International, coordinated by Teresa Cunha Ferreira and directed to the study of management and conservation of the Piscina de Marés complex, in Leça da Palmeira, designed by Álvaro Siza between 1960 and 1973, just guaranteed a financing of 100 thousand euros under the “Keeping It Modern” program, promoted by the prestigious Getty Foundation (USA).
